Description

Model LCM200 is a Miniature Tension and Compression Load Cell built for Endurance or Inline Tension or Compression applications. The standard LCM200 Miniature Tension and Compression Load Cell model has a very robust construction available in 17-4 Stainless Steel, with male threads on both ends and a 10 feet long 29 AWG 4 conductor shielded Teflon cable. This product offers an exceptional weight of 0.6 oz (17 g). You will also find options for external matched output readily available.

The Miniature Tension and Compression Load Cell offers high accuracy. It has Nonlinearity of ±0.5% and Deflection of 0.002” nominal. The standard LCM200 Miniature Tension and Compression Load Cell can be modified or customized to meet your requirements and most capacities are in our inventory, making them available for 24-hour shipping. Similar to our entire Load Cell product line this model is manufactured in the USA and uses metal foil strain gauge technology.

Features

  • Minimal mounting clearance
  • 17-4 stainless-steel construction
  • For use in both tension and compression
  • Adheres to RoHS directive 2015/863/EU
  • Accessories and related instruments available
